On Mon, 13 Jul 1998, Nicolas Blais wrote: > Hi, > > I installed X-Window on my FreeBSD 3.0 system. I use xinit to load it. Don't -- use startx. > I would like to know how to load xinit in 800x600x16bpp. Here is what I > have in the .xinitrc file: startx -bpp 16 Hit Control-alt-greyplus when you get it to increase the resolution.
